Hi, I have booked a flight from PEN-SIN in J with an MAS flight number, but the flight is a codeshare operated by SilkAir. I have gone around in circles trying to understand where I should accrue any points I can get from this flight. I am Qantas WP, so understand Oneworld, but am discovering that once I deviate from OW things get difficult.

MAS is a partner with Virgin Blue and I am a Velocity member. This is probably where the points would be most valuable to me. However the t&c seem to suggest that codeshare flights not operated by a DJ partner don't count. Is this correct?

The next best outcome is if I can accrue to KrisFlyer, since I might be doing some longhaul SQ flights later this year as well (they are consistently undercutting QF/BA and work has a cheapest fare of the day policy).

The least attractive option is accrue to Enrich, since I doubt that I will ever get enough points to do anything with.

Hopefully one of the experts out there can give me some suggestions?

IME one cannot accrue miles/points to a *A program if the flight is operated AND marketed by a non-*A airline.... so in this case I THINK a Silk Air flight number would allow crediting to KF (or maybe not, maybe only am SQ flight number would do???).... but I suspect the MH flight number will be a deal killer....
